
SDN多控制器动态部署:双向匹配优化算法
1.04MB |
更新于2024-08-29
| 169 浏览量 | 举报
收藏
"SDN中基于双向匹配的多控制器动态部署算法是为了解决分布式软件定义网络中的控制器负载不均衡问题。该算法由胡涛、张建辉、孔维功、杨森和曹路佳等人提出,他们来自国家数字交换系统工程技术研究中心。此算法的关键在于利用交换机和控制器的匹配列表以及模拟退火算法来优化控制器的部署,从而提高系统的效率和性能。
在SDN架构中,控制器是网络的核心组件,负责处理来自交换机的流请求并执行网络策略。然而,随着网络规模的扩大,控制器可能会面临负载不均衡的问题,这可能导致某些控制器过载,而其他控制器则处于空闲状态。这种不平衡会增加流请求的排队时延,影响整体网络性能。
为解决这一问题,该算法首先周期性地收集网络中的关键信息,包括交换机到控制器的跳数、通信延迟和流量数据。这些数据用于构建交换机和控制器的匹配列表。接着,依据优化原则对这两个列表进行排序,然后执行双向匹配过程,即在交换机和控制器之间建立最优连接。在此过程中,模拟退火算法被用来不断调整和优化匹配关系,以寻求最佳的控制器分配方案。
模拟退火算法是一种全局优化技术,借鉴了物理学中的退火过程,能够在搜索空间中进行全局探索,避免陷入局部最优,从而找到更接近全局最优的解决方案。在SDN的上下文中,它有助于在控制器和交换机之间找到一个既能平衡负载又能减少时延的匹配配置。
仿真结果显示,与传统的部署方法相比,该双向匹配算法显著改善了控制器的负载均衡情况,控制器的负载均衡率提高了至少17.9%,并且有效地降低了流请求的排队时延。这些改进对于维持SDN的高效运行和提升用户体验具有重要意义。
关键词涵盖"软件定义网络"、"控制器"、"负载均衡"和"双向匹配",表明该研究关注的核心领域和采用的技术手段。中图分类号TP393则将该研究定位在通信技术的计算机网络部分,文献标识码A表示这是一篇原创性的科研文章,doi标识则提供了文章的唯一数字标识,便于后续引用和检索。
SDN中基于双向匹配的多控制器动态部署算法是一项创新性的工作,旨在通过优化控制器部署策略,解决SDN中的核心问题,即控制器的负载不均衡,以提升整个网络的性能和稳定性。"
相关推荐










weixin_38655878
- 粉丝: 5
最新资源
- MySQL 5.1中文版官方文档解读
- C++开发带界面的通讯录应用
- SQL Server数据库备份与恢复的高效软件解决方案
- JSP中实现漂亮日期选择控件的技巧
- 上海应用技术学院结构化学习题课课件汇总
- 基于ASP.NET和SQL2000的体育用品销售网站开发
- 数据结构1800题及答案详解:全面覆盖考点
- C++编写简易词法分析器教程
- MapGuide开源GIS软件培训教程
- Java反编译工具: 从class到java文件的转换
- C#实现不规则窗口设计与平面布置技巧
- 探索CS仿真程序的C++源码
- IPMsg多语言支持版发布:解决日文Windows中文消息兼容性
- PB反编译工具:探索与贡献pb资源的新途径
- 探索AuthorWare创作的艺术与技巧
- C语言开发的全面职工信息管理系统
- ACCP Y2题集:含答案及注解,助力IT信心重建
- 图形界面操作系统进程调度系统设计
- JavaScript网页特效大全及实例教程
- Delphi IOCP控件原码解读与游戏开发应用
- 综合电子阅读器工具包:支持多种格式
- VB实现SQL Server数据库批量附加的方法
- 掌握JavaScript源文件的压缩与管理技巧
- 精选常用软件图标集锦